One of the key themes of this book is the evolution of warfare. As technology advanced, so did the nature of warfare. From swords and shields to tanks and fighter jets, each era has seen significant advancements in weapons and military technology. The book explores how these advancements changed the way wars were fought and how they impacted the outcome of battles.
Another important theme is the political and social ramifications of war. Many wars have had far-reaching consequences that have affected the course of history long after the battles were fought. The book examines how wars have shaped societies and economies, and how they have influenced international relations and diplomacy.
It is worth noting that the book does not glorify war, nor does it seek to justify or excuse acts of violence. Instead, it aims to provide an objective and informative account of the most dangerous wars in history. By examining the causes and consequences of these conflicts, we can gain a better understanding of the human condition and how we interact with one another.
As the world continues to face conflicts and tensions, it is important to remember the lessons of the past. By studying history, we can learn from our mistakes and work towards a more peaceful and prosperous future. This book serves as a reminder of the cost of war and the importance of striving for peace and cooperation among nations.
In conclusion, "Stories of the Most Dangerous Wars in Human History" is a valuable resource for anyone interested in the history of warfare and its impact on the world. It provides a comprehensive and informative overview of the deadliest and most consequential wars that have shaped human history. By delving deep into the causes, events, and aftermath of these conflicts, the book provides a nuanced and insightful look into the complexities of human conflict.
